Nokia 7.1 full Specification, Price 19,999 on 7th December 2018
Nokia 7.1, the latest smartphone from HMD Global's home, has been launched in India. For the first time in a program in London last month was unveiled, the smartphone has a pure display panel with HDR 10 password, in which its primary highlight is. Other Nokia 7.1 highlights include a dual rear camera setup with Zeus optics and 3,060 mAh battery with 18W Fast Charging. On Friday, HMD Global unveiled the launch price of Nokia 7.1 in India, its release date, as well as a press release through a press release.
Nokia 7.1 price in India
Nokia 7.1 price in India is fixed at Rs. 19,999 (recommended best purchase price) for your 4 GB RAM / 64GB inbuilt storage variant, and it will go on sale in the country from December 7. Smartphone will be available to buy in India through top mobile retailers, HMD Global said in a statement, in addition to Nokia's own online store. The 3GB RAM / 32GB storage version - which was launched in London - has not yet been introduced in India, and in the future it will not be available in any country that there is no word on it.

For the Nokia 7.1 launch offer, the company has partnered with Airtel so that the prepaid subscribers will get Rs. 1 on the eligible plans of 1GB 4G data. 199. On the other hand, postpaid Airtel customers will get additional 120 GB data with a three-month Netflix subscription and one-year Amazon Prime Subscription, which will be available for postpaid plans. 49 9 or higher. Those who decide to purchase Nokia 7.1, using HDFC Credit and Debit Card in addition to EMI transactions, will get 10 percent cashback through a qualified offline store.

Nokia 7.1 specification
Based on the Android One program, Dual SIM Nokia (Nano) 7.1 Android Oreo runs in, with Android 9.0 pie update, over-the-air is reaching for buyers in India. It plays with 5.84 inch full-HD + (1080x2280 pixels) net display panel with 19: 9 aspect ratio, HDR 10 support, and Corning Gorilla Glass 3 protection. The handset is powered by a Qualcomm Snapdragon 636 SOC, which has been connected with 4 GB RAM.
In the case of optics, Nokia 7.1 has a vertical alliance pair of dual rear camera setup, with 12 megapixel primary sensor, which has F / 1.8 aperture and fixed focus and F / 2.4 aperture (5-megapixel secondary sensor with autofocus) . In addition to the EIS, the company is also exploring two-step detection and ZEISS optics for back-up camera setup. On the front, the handset comes with 8 megapixel Fixed Focus Sensor F / 2.0 aperture and 84 degree field-view. 64 GB is inbuilt storage, which can be expanded through the microSD card (up to 400 GB).
Connectivity options on Nokia 7.1 include 4G LTE, Wi-Fi 802.11 AC, Bluetooth V5, GPS / A-GPS, GLONASS, NFC, USB Type-C, and 3.5mm headphone jack. On the smartphone the sensor includes accelerometer, ambient light sensor, electronic compass, gyroscope, proximity sensor, and a rear-mounted fingerprint sensor.
